The Epson SureColor F2000 is a high-performance printer designed specifically for textile printing. It provides exceptional print quality and efficiency, making it a popular choice among professional garment printers and textile manufacturers.

Installing the Epson SureColor F2000 Driver

This section will provide a detailed guide on how to install the Epson SureColor F2000 driver on various operating systems, including Windows, macOS, and Linux.

Step-by-step guide to installing the Epson SureColor F2000 driver

Follow these steps to install the Epson SureColor F2000 driver on your operating system:

For Windows users:

  1. First, make sure your Epson SureColor F2000 printer is connected to your computer via USB or network.
  2. Visit the Epson website and navigate to the support section.
  3. Search for the SureColor F2000 printer model and locate the appropriate driver.
  4. Download the driver file to your computer.
  5. Once the download is complete, double-click on the driver file to begin the installation process.
  6. Follow the on-screen instructions and accept the license agreement.
  7. Choose the installation location and click "Install" to start the installation.
  8. Wait for the installation to finish and then restart your computer.
  9. Once your computer restarts, your Epson SureColor F2000 driver will be installed and ready to use.

For macOS users:

  1. Ensure that your Epson SureColor F2000 printer is connected to your Mac via USB or network.
  2. Visit the Epson website and find the support section.
  3. Search for the SureColor F2000 printer model and download the appropriate driver for macOS.
  4. Locate the driver file in your Downloads folder and double-click on it.
  5. Follow the on-screen instructions to install the driver.
  6. Restart your Mac to complete the installation process.
  7. After restarting, your Epson SureColor F2000 driver will be successfully installed on your Mac.

For Linux users:

  1. Connect your Epson SureColor F2000 printer to your Linux computer via USB or network.
  2. Open a web browser and go to the Epson website.
  3. Access the support section and search for the SureColor F2000 printer model.
  4. Download the appropriate driver for your Linux distribution.
  5. Open the terminal on your Linux computer.
  6. Navigate to the directory where the driver file is located.
  7. Run the command to install the driver, following the instructions provided by Epson for your specific Linux distribution.
  8. Restart your computer to complete the installation process.

Troubleshooting common installation issues

If you encounter any problems during the installation of the Epson SureColor F2000 driver, try the following solutions:

  • Ensure that your computer meets the system requirements specified by Epson for the driver.
  • Disconnect and reconnect the USB or network connection between your computer and the printer.
  • Make sure you have downloaded the correct driver file for your operating system and printer model.
  • Disable any antivirus or firewall software temporarily while installing the driver.
  • If the installation still fails, contact Epson support for further assistance.

Troubleshooting printing issues with the Epson SureColor F2000 Driver

Printing issues are not uncommon, and the Epson SureColor F2000 driver provides troubleshooting features to help users resolve them effectively. In this section, we will discuss common printing issues and provide tips for troubleshooting them.

If you encounter issues such as banding or streaks in your prints, it is recommended to perform a printhead cleaning through the driver interface. This process helps unclog and restore the printhead nozzles, ensuring consistent ink flow and preventing print defects.

Another common issue is color mismatch or inaccurate color reproduction. In such cases, it is advisable to check the color management settings in the driver and ensure that they are correctly configured. Additionally, using ICC profiles specific to your media and ink combination can significantly improve color accuracy.

Print alignment problems can also arise, resulting in misaligned or skewed prints. The driver offers alignment adjustment options that allow users to fine-tune the positioning of the print image. By utilizing these features, users can align the print image accurately and eliminate any misalignment issues.

Additional Software and Utilities for the Epson SureColor F2000 Printer

In addition to the driver, Epson offers supplementary software and utilities that can enhance the printing experience with the SureColor F2000 printer.

One such tool is the Epson Print Layout software. This software provides advanced layout features and ensures accurate color reproduction for professional-quality prints. It allows users to preview and adjust their designs before sending them to print, saving time and reducing waste.

The Epson Garment Creator software is another valuable tool for SureColor F2000 users. This software enables easy customization of garments by adding text, images, and effects. It simplifies the process of creating personalized prints, making it ideal for businesses in the apparel industry or individuals looking to add a personal touch to their clothing items.
